SOME of the best tourism businesses in the region have been revealed by Make it York. The destination management organisation has announced the finalists for its Visit York Tourism Awards 2026. Now in its 28th year, the Visit York Tourism Awards, sponsored by LNER, celebrate the best in tourism, hospitality and culture.

Tourism-dependent businesses around the North York Moors National Park have said that a wildfire that has been burning for three weeks has been impacting their trade during peak season. The blaze began on Langdale Moor on 11 August and spread earlier this week, although the fire service has now said the incident has been "contained".
